About Rong Bing

Rong Bing is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Epidemiology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Surgery, having authored 57 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(31 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(20 papers),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(14 papers), Coronary Interventions and Diagnostics (8 papers),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(7 papers), Acute Myocardial Infarction Research (7 papers), Cerebrovascular and Carotid Artery Diseases (7 papers) and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(874 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(475 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(219 citations), Infectious Diseases (251 citations) and Pollution (149 citations). Rong Bing has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Marc R. Dweck, David E. Newby, Nicholas L. Mills, Kuan Ken Lee, Anoop Shah, Anda Bularga, Russell J. Everett, Marie‐Annick Clavel, David McAllister and Anthony M. Heagerty. Their work appears in journals such as Heart, JACC. Cardiovascular imaging, European Heart Journal, European Heart Journal - Cardiovascular Imaging and Circulation Cardiovascular Imaging.
